> IMPORTANT: The file 'Yamaha Classics.ins' (included in the download  
> below) contains the following instrument definitions: AN1X, DX7, EMT10,  
> MU50, P100, PROMIX 01, PSR300, PSR500, PSR520, PSR530, PSR6700,
> QS300, QY10, SPX90, SY22, SY35, SY55, SY77, SY85, SY99, TG33, TG100,  
> TG300, TG500, TX7, VL70.
